Mac Accessibility From: Macworld.com - 04/23/2008 By: Christopher Breen Josh's Lioncourt.com is a great resource for those visually impaired Mac users but there are others. Apple offers its own accessibility page with links to a variety of resources. Josh also mentioned the Screenless Switchers podcast, a podcast produced by Darcy Burnard and Holly Anderson, two visually impaired women who've moved from Windows to the Mac.
